This role involves the evaluation and rehabilitation of patients across all age groups who exhibit communication and oral-pharyngeal disorders. The Speech Pathologist will document patient progress, provide instruction to patients and caregivers, and contribute to program development and staff mentoring.
Responsibilities
- Evaluate and rehabilitate patients of all ages with communication and oral-pharyngeal disorders
- Document findings and patient progress
- Provide instruction to patients and caregivers
- Provide recommendations and assist with program development
- Serve as resource and mentor to assistants, students, interns, and rehabilitation technicians
Requirements
- Graduate of an accredited university-based Speech/Language pathology program
- Awarded a Masters degree in Speech/Language Pathology
- Current license to practice speech/language pathology in Texas
- Current certification from the American Speech-Language-Hearing Association
- Current Certification in Basic Life Support
